Prompt

Style ReferenceCreate a stylized graphic design poster featuring a photorealistic central subject set against a textured, off-white background with subtle horizontal lines or a paper-like grain. The composition should be centered and balanced, using a high-contrast, editorial layout reminiscent of a magazine cover or contemporary advertisement. The visual aesthetic blends retro and modern elements, combining photographic realism for the subject with bold, layered typography and flat graphic overlays. Employ a controlled color palette dominated by vibrant, high-saturation primary accents—specifically deep cobalt blue and bright red—contrasted against neutral tones (black, white, grey, brown) and the subject's natural skin tones, creating a striking, high-contrast visual hierarchy. Lighting should be soft, even, and frontal, minimizing harsh shadows to give the subject a clear, approachable presence while maintaining a flat, studio-like quality that emphasizes the graphic nature of the composition. Textures should be rendered with detail, from woven fabrics and smooth leather to matte finishes and paper-like backgrounds, enhancing the tactile, printed feel. The composition should use a strong central axis with layered elements: the subject may be partially obscured by or integrated with large, bold sans-serif typography and flowing cursive script overlays, creating depth through overlapping geometric and organic shapes. The mood should be confident, professional, and slightly ironic or provocative, conveying conceptual messages through direct gazes, obscured faces, or symbolic props (vintage phones, books, sticky notes). Text elements should be in Portuguese, using a mix of bold sans-serif headlines and elegant cursive scripts, playing a key role in delivering persuasive or introspective messages about branding, positioning, and professional value.
